Ultrasound-assisted dispersive liquid-liquid microextraction for determination of three gliflozins in human plasma by HPLC/DAD.

A novel, highly sensitive ultrasound-assisted dispersive liquid-liquid microextraction (UA-DLLME) high performance liquid chromatography with diode-array detection (HPLC/DAD) method was developed for the determination of empagliflozin, dapagliflozin and canagliflozin in human plasma using methanol as protein precipitating agent/disperser and 1-dodecanol as extracting solvent. The analytes were eluted with an isocratic mobile phase consisting of acetonitrile:aqueous 0.1% trifluoroacetic acid pH 2.5, (40:60, v/v), at a flow rate of 1 mL/min and UV detection at 210 nm. The microextraction conditions were optimized regarding type and volume of extractant, type of disperser, sample pH, extraction time and centrifugation time. Under the optimal conditions, the enrichment factors were 19 for empagliflozin, 27 for dapagliflozin and 50 for canagliflozin. Linearity ranges were 2-2500 ng/mL, 3.5-2500 ng/mL and 1.1-2500 ng/mL for empagliflozin, dapagliflozin and canagliflozin, respectively. The developed method employs very small volumes of organic solvents in sample extraction and allows determination of small concetrations of gliflozins in human plasma.

超声辅助分散液-液微萃取,用于通过HPLC / DAD测定人血浆中的三种格列净。

开发了一种新型的高灵敏度超声辅助分散液-液微萃取(UA-DLLME)高效液相色谱-二极管阵列检测(HPLC / DAD)方法,以甲醇为标准品测定人血浆中的恩帕格列净,达格列净和坎格列净蛋白质沉淀剂/分散剂和1-十二烷醇作为提取溶剂。将分析物用等度流动相洗脱,该流动相由乙腈:0.1%三氟乙酸水溶液pH 2.5(40:60,v / v)组成,流速为1 mL / min,并在210 nm处进行UV检测。针对萃取剂的类型和体积,分散器的类型,样品的pH值,萃取时间和离心时间对微萃取条件进行了优化。在最佳条件下,依帕列净的富集因子为19,达帕列净的富集因子为27,而卡那列净的富集因子为50。依格列净,达格列净和canagliflozin的线性范围分别为2-2500 ng / mL,3.5-2500 ng / mL和1.1-2500 ng / mL。所开发的方法在样品提取中使用非常少量的有机溶剂,并可以测定人血浆中小浓度的格列净。
